
Worked on enhancing F# tooling within the JetBrains/resharper-fsharp repository, focusing on both feature development and stability improvements. Delivered a backend-driven F# syntax error checker for the Junie feature, leveraging source file analysis and reorganizing modules under AICore to support more accurate diagnostics. Addressed plugin compilation issues by adapting to daemon API changes and refining warning handling to respect project configurations. Additionally, implemented project type GUID normalization and multi-type support, improving project-type management and reducing configuration drift. Utilized F#, dotnet development, and software architecture skills to increase reliability, maintainability, and feedback speed for contributors and end users.
